    Original or Service 6 qt Oil pan???

    I have a small mystery. I acquired a very nice 6qt pan with the trap door and have read the archives and understand how to differentiate between the two. I even purchased a 5qt pan in error and successfully identified it as the ORIGINAL type with the 2.25" real radius.

    Here's my Dilemma - the seal radius on the pan in question measures 2 5/16" - right inbetween the 2 1/4" mark for the original (3820001) and the 2 3/8" mark for the service replacements (359942). This pan is in very good shape and appears to be straight and true.

    CAn someone help me identify this pan?

    Re: Original or Service 6 qt Oil pan???

    Probably original. Make sure that the straight edge (level) is flat across the circumference where it meets the flats. If you are going across the flats, then that 1/16" will very easily be made up. You should be able to use the heavier front seal in your gasket set, and dry fit the pan. If you use the thinner seal, the front of your engine will leak like a sieve.
